More about Courtyard Bristol

Courtyard Bristol

Situated in Bristol, Courtyard Bristol offers 3-star accommodation with a shared lounge and a bar. Featuring a restaurant, the property also has free bikes, as well as an indoor pool and a fitness centre.

Kindness in our moment of raw pain.

• My husband and I had to drive from New Jersey to Alabama. Our son had passed. Technically, he was our son-in-law. But to our hearts he was our son. It had just happened and we were driving down to be with our daughter. However the loss was still very raw. Our hearts were broken. On this trip, Afton was at the front desk. They were so very compassionate. Truly. Kind words that felt so warm. They wrote us a sympathy card. It didn't feel like canned words they are told to say. It seemed very heartfelt. I couldn't help but ask if a hug was ok. Our daughter kept that card with the things for her husband.
• About a week later, headed back to New Jersey, we still thought of the kindness at this location. So we just called ahead to make our reservation for that night. Gabe was working the front desk. There was a card of sympathy and thinking of you waitingfor us in our room. Again we felt so, I don't know, maybe seen is the correct word. When you have a close loved one pass, it feels so weird for the world to just continue on. So it feels comforting to have our pain acknowledged. I feel like I'm saying that so wrong. Anyhow, then sitting at the Cafe waiting for our dinner, a memory hit me and I started crying again. My husband got me some drink napkins to wipe my eyes. Gabe came scooting over So Fast with a box of tissues. Saying those would be softer. Again, seen. His card is in with item in our memorial for our son.
• Anyhow, in the morning we had Afton at the front desk again. I couldn't help but ask for a hug, again. We had time to talk a little and it was like talking with an old friend. Almost catching up. We both shared heart felt.moments. when i saw Afton.at.the front desk, I think both my husband and I fully smiled. Those so kind interactions, even though few, felt like so much beyond customer service. You can't train that. It's just good people. Thank you deeply, seriously, for having good people.

The room overall was clean , the bathroom could use some maintenance from where they removed some things from the shower and around areas around glass partition at back of bath/shower could use a deeper cleaning ( mold buildup) . It wasn’t nasty just makes it look dirty. There were plenty of towels and stuff in the bathroom. Bed linens were nice and clean ( I’ve had bad experiences at other places, where they looked like they weren’t clean and had hair all over them) not here , they were crisp clean. Front deck ladies were very nice and helpful. Parking was easy and I was able to find spaces close to the front.
